- 氵(water; liquid)
- 酉(wine vessel (pictographic))
Alcohol is a liquid stored in a vessel and fermented from grain.
wine, sex, avarice and temper (idiom); four cardinal vices
Alcohol, lust, wealth, and pride are the four great harms of human life.
